This clinical trial is being conducted to assess whether the rotary polypectomy snare could decrease the time to removal of colorectal polyps

The technique is hot snare resection of the polyp with electrocautery. Details are as follows: (1) insert the snare into the colonoscopy; (2) connect the snare with the high-frequency device;(3) advance sliding handle to open the loop; (4) adjust the direction of the snare by rotating the handle as required, rotate the loop until the loop reaches target polyp; (6) encircle the target polyp with loop; (7) pull the sliding handle, lasso the target polyp;(8) resect the polyp with electrocautery, then inhaling the transected polyp into a trap followed by submission to the histological evaluation.

the average time of each polyp removing
Using a stopwatch to record the removing time of each polyp (starting the stopwatch when the snare stretched out of the pipe and ending with the polyp being completely removed); Furthermore, we excluded the time of submucosal injection, electrocoagulation, and the use of preventive titanium clips
Time frame: 1day
